1. Understanding Your Face Shape and Ideal Brow Arch
Before you even think about tweezers, you need to understand the ideal eyebrow shape for your face. Different brow shapes complement different facial features. For instance, a strong, angular brow might suit a round face, while a softer, more rounded arch might be better suited to a square face.
- Round Faces: High arches with a slight angle create the illusion of length.
- Oval Faces: Soft arches that follow the natural bone structure are flattering.
- Square Faces: Rounded arches soften the strong lines of the face.
- Heart-Shaped Faces: Slightly arched brows with a soft tail balance the heart shape.
- Long Faces: Flatter brows with a gentle curve shorten the appearance of the face.

2. Mapping Your Perfect Brow
Precise mapping is crucial for achieving symmetrical and naturally beautiful eyebrows. This technique helps you define the ideal starting point, arch height, and ending point of your brows.
- Starting Point: Hold a pencil vertically against the side of your nose, aligning it with the inner corner of your eye. This is where your brow should begin.
- Arch Point: Angle the pencil from the side of your nose through the center of your pupil. This point marks the highest part of your brow arch.
- Ending Point: Angle the pencil from the side of your nose through the outer corner of your eye. This is where your brow should end.

3. Choosing Your Eyebrow Shaping Method: Tweezing, Threading, or Waxing
Choosing the right eyebrow shaping method depends on your pain tolerance, skin sensitivity, and desired results.
- Tweezing: This is a precise method suitable for removing individual hairs. It’s ideal for maintenance and shaping smaller areas.
- Threading: A precise and effective technique that uses twisted cotton thread to remove hair. It’s known for its long-lasting results and gentle nature.
- Waxing: A faster method for removing larger areas of hair. However, it can be more painful and potentially lead to irritation or ingrown hairs.
Consider consulting a professional aesthetician for waxing or threading, especially for your first time to ensure precise and safe results. Remember to always sanitize your tools before and after use, regardless of the method you choose.
4. The Art of Eyebrow Shaping: Step-by-Step Guide
Once you’ve mapped your brows and chosen your method, it’s time to begin shaping. Remember to work slowly and carefully, removing only the hairs outside of your mapped area.
- Cleanse the area: Prepare your skin by cleansing it thoroughly.
- Apply a numbing cream (optional): For sensitive skin, a numbing cream can minimize discomfort.
- Shape your brows: Carefully remove hairs outside your mapped guidelines.
- Maintain symmetry: Regularly check for symmetry between your eyebrows.
- Cleanse again: Remove any remaining product or stray hairs.
5. Post-Shaping Care: Soothing and Protecting Your Brows
Proper aftercare is essential to prevent irritation and ingrown hairs.
- Apply a soothing aloe vera gel: This helps to calm the skin and reduce redness.
- Avoid harsh scrubbing: Be gentle when cleansing the area.
- Exfoliate regularly: This helps prevent ingrown hairs.
- Keep the area moisturized: Use a light moisturizer to keep the skin hydrated.
Ignoring aftercare can lead to irritation, infection, and potentially unsightly ingrown hairs.
6. Enhancing Your Brows with Makeup
Once your brows are perfectly shaped, you can enhance their natural beauty with makeup.
- Brow pencils: Create natural-looking hair strokes to fill in sparse areas.
- Brow powders: Provides a soft and natural-looking fill.
- Brow gels: Sets hairs in place and adds definition.
Choose products that complement your hair color and brow tone.
7. Maintaining Your Perfect Arches: Ongoing Care
Maintaining your perfect arches requires consistent effort. Regular tweezing, threading, or waxing maintains the desired shape. Depending on your hair growth, you may need to shape your brows every 1-3 weeks.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How often should I shape my eyebrows?
A: The frequency depends on your hair growth rate. Most people need to shape their brows every 1-3 weeks.
Q2: What should I do if I accidentally over-pluck my eyebrows?
A: Don’t panic! Allow your brows to grow back naturally. In the meantime, you can use brow pencils or powders to fill in any sparse areas. Patience is key.
Q3: Are there any risks associated with eyebrow shaping?
A: There are potential risks such as infection, ingrown hairs, and irritation, particularly with waxing. Proper hygiene and aftercare are crucial to minimize these risks. Always use clean tools and follow appropriate aftercare instructions.
Q4: Can I shape my eyebrows at home, or should I go to a professional?
A: Both options are possible. For beginners, it’s recommended to consult a professional for the initial shaping to ensure proper technique. Once you’ve established a good shape, you can maintain it at home.
Q5: What are some common mistakes to avoid when shaping my eyebrows?
A: Over-plucking is a common mistake. Another is not considering your face shape when choosing a brow shape. Finally, neglecting aftercare can lead to unwanted issues.
